Web(1) The haircuts to be applied to readily marketable assets of each kind are as set out in table 9.7.6. The haircut for an asset is to be applied to the mark-to-market value of the asset. (2) For the table, an asset is investment grade if it is rated no lower than BBB- (long-term) or A-3 (short-term) by Standard & Poor's (or the equivalent by ...
